All posts

Enforcement Secure API Access Proxy: A Practical Guide to Secure Your APIs

API security has become a top priority for organizations, with breaches often leading to sensitive data exposure and operational risks. To mitigate these issues, an enforcement secure API access proxy acts as an essential layer, ensuring that only authorized users and services can interact with your APIs. Here's how it works, why it matters, and how you can implement it effectively. What is an Enforcement Secure API Access Proxy? An enforcement secure API access proxy is a gateway that sits b

Free White Paper

VNC Secure Access + Database Access Proxy: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

API security has become a top priority for organizations, with breaches often leading to sensitive data exposure and operational risks. To mitigate these issues, an enforcement secure API access proxy acts as an essential layer, ensuring that only authorized users and services can interact with your APIs. Here's how it works, why it matters, and how you can implement it effectively.


What is an Enforcement Secure API Access Proxy?

An enforcement secure API access proxy is a gateway that sits between API consumers and API providers, enforcing security policies and regulating API access. It ensures compliance with rules, verifies identities, and monitors traffic to prevent unauthorized access.

Unlike simple API gateways, this type of proxy is purpose-built for securing APIs by enforcing access controls, inspecting requests, and validating tokens or credentials. It serves as a scalable shield that lets engineering teams focus on building features instead of reinventing security mechanisms for every endpoint.


Core Features of an Enforcement Secure API Access Proxy

1. Authentication Enforcement

An API proxy ensures that only authenticated users or services can access your APIs. It supports protocols like OAuth 2.0, OpenID Connect, and API keys to validate credentials efficiently.

  • What it does: Verifies if the entity interacting with the API is who they claim to be.
  • Why it matters: Prevents unauthorized access and reduces risks of data breaches.

2. Authorization Controls

Authorization checks go beyond identification. They ensure that users or services only access resources or operations they are explicitly allowed to.

  • How it works: Role-based or attribute-based access controls (RBAC/ABAC) are enforced, limiting the scope of interactions based on defined rules.
  • Why you need this: To prevent privilege escalation or unintentional exposure of sensitive APIs.

3. Request Validation

The proxy filters incoming requests to ensure they are safe and adhere to API specifications. It can enforce rules like rate limiting, schema validation, and payload inspection.

  • What’s validated: Content type, headers, query strings, body format, and more.
  • Why you should care: Shields the backend APIs from invalid data that could trigger errors or exploits.

4. Threat Detection and Mitigation

Modern enforcement proxies monitor API traffic for patterns or anomalies that indicate abuse or attacks.

Continue reading? Get the full guide.

VNC Secure Access + Database Access Proxy: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.
  • Common threats blocked: SQL injection, cross-site scripting (XSS), and DDoS attempts.
  • Why it stands out: Combines access policies with real-time monitoring to ensure ongoing protection.

5. Logging and Analytics

An enforcement proxy logs all API interactions, generating data for monitoring and auditing. Advanced proxies even provide searchable logs and analytics dashboards for better visibility.

  • What it tracks: Request volumes, response times, errors, and unauthorized attempts.
  • Why it helps: Enables engineering and security teams to debug issues, optimize performance, and ensure compliance.

Benefits of Using an Enforcement Secure API Access Proxy

  1. Streamlined Security Integration: Simplifies how APIs enforce core security functions across diverse environments.
  2. Improved Compliance: Ensures APIs meet internal standards and external regulatory requirements.
  3. Enhanced Scalability: Offloads security responsibilities while maintaining high performance for growing API traffic.
  4. Centralized Management: Unified enforcement of policies across microservices and distributed APIs.
  5. Time Savings: Reduces repetitive configurations and custom coding for API security.

Steps to Implement an Enforcement Secure API Access Proxy

Step 1: Evaluate Your API Security Requirements

Identify your key challenges, whether it's role-based access, threat detection, or compliance audits.

Step 2: Choose the Right Proxy Solution

Look for solutions supporting the latest security protocols, compatibility with your existing tooling, and scalability.

Step 3: Define Security Policies

Create and document authentication rules, token validation methods, and request validators.

Step 4: Integrate the Proxy

Position the proxy in your API architecture as the enforcement layer, with updated DNS and routing rules.

Step 5: Monitor and Iterate

Continuously monitor logs and analytics from the proxy to fix gaps and improve performance.


See It in Action

A secure API access proxy isn’t just a concept; it’s something you can deploy and benefit from almost immediately. At Hoop.dev, we understand the complexities of API security and offer tools that let you implement smart API security in minutes.

Experience the simplicity of enforcement proxy setup and regain confidence in your API defenses. Explore Hoop.dev today and see it live.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ts